Natural Elements and Materials
Biophilic design in luxury resort settings begins with the thoughtful selection and artful integration of natural elements and materials. From the rugged stone facades and timber-clad exteriors that blend seamlessly with the surrounding landscape, to the soothing water features and lush indoor gardens that create a serene ambiance, these carefully curated design choices evoke a profound sense of place and immerse guests in the beauty of the natural world.
By utilizing local, sustainably-sourced materials such as reclaimed wood, native stone, and handcrafted artisanal pieces, luxury resorts not only cultivate a strong sense of authenticity, but also minimize their environmental impact. The strategic deployment of these natural elements – be it the rough-hewn beams overhead, the intricate stone mosaics underfoot, or the cascading greenery lining the corridors – engages the senses and triggers a positive, almost primal response, making guests feel grounded, relaxed, and connected to their surroundings.
Organic Shapes and Textures
Complementing the use of natural materials, the incorporation of organic shapes and textures is another hallmark of biophilic design in the luxury resort context. Curved archways, undulating walls, and sinuous furniture forms echo the fluid lines and gentle contours found in the natural world, creating a soothing, harmonious ambiance that stands in stark contrast to the rigid geometries so often associated with modern architecture.
These biomorphic design elements, inspired by the patterns and structures of living organisms, stimulate the senses and evoke a feeling of familiarity and comfort. From the sculpted stone basin of an outdoor shower to the weathered wooden benches nestled within a lush courtyard, each sensory experience is carefully curated to cultivate a deep, almost primal connection between the guest and their surroundings.
Biophilic Spatial Configurations
In addition to the intentional use of natural materials and organic forms, luxury resorts are increasingly leveraging biophilic spatial configurations to enhance the guest experience and promote overall wellness. Thoughtful placement of prospect and refuge areas, for example, allows guests to enjoy both expansive vistas and intimate, sheltered spaces, catering to their innate need for both visual control and a sense of safety and security.
The strategic integration of transitional zones, both interior and exterior, further strengthens the connection between the built and natural environments. Covered walkways, open-air courtyards, and seamlessly blended indoor-outdoor living spaces encourage guests to move fluidly between different environments, fostering a deeper appreciation for the rhythms and cycles of the natural world.

Sustainability and Environmental Stewardship
Underlying the luxury resort’s commitment to biophilic design is a steadfast dedication to sustainability and environmental stewardship. By incorporating resource-efficient design strategies, eco-friendly operations, and conservation initiatives, these resorts not only minimize their carbon footprint, but also actively contribute to the preservation of the very natural environments that inspire their design.
From the use of renewable, low-impact building materials to the implementation of water-wise landscaping and energy-efficient systems, luxury resorts are setting new standards for sustainable hospitality. Moreover, many resorts actively engage in habitat restoration, wildlife conservation, and community-based environmental programs, fostering a deep sense of responsibility and custodianship among both staff and guests.
